Correct Me If I'm Wrong

Rating: 5.0


C-orrect me if I'm wrong,
H-elping me to adjust;
E-rrors start from Eden,
R-eal man is made of dust.
R-ight me if I'm unjust,
Y-ou can see it in my eyes;
L-et me restore to proper place,
Y-our input is so
N-ice.

C-ounsel me if I'm loose,
A-ugust seventeenth day;
G-uide me to the true road,
U-nliking the false pathway.
I-nnocence justifies no one,
M-istakes do the same;
B-e there not to blame,
A-dvise if my excuse is
L-ame.
